Output 39f0fbefb000b44fd8468aeeae522eb730f80d3ec9862e98ec9afb1e536a73ad:3

value
23758971
script pubkey
OP_0 OP_PUSHBYTES_20 e0145df166b20db925a3f7492889a5eb5ff6d363
address
bc1quq29mutxkgxmjfdr7ayj3zd9ad0ld5mrhh89l2
transaction
39f0fbefb000b44fd8468aeeae522eb730f80d3ec9862e98ec9afb1e536a73ad
spent
true